Abstract

In this paper, the problem of non-regular static state feedback linearization of affine nonlinear systems is considered. First of all, a new canonical form for non-regular feedback linear systems is proposed. Using this form, a recursive algorithm is presented, which yields a condition for single input linearization. Then the left semi-tensor product of matrices is introduced and several new properties are developed. Using the recursive framework and new matrix product, a formula is presented for normal form algorithm. Based on it, a set of conditions for single-input (approximate) linearizability is presented.
